LINUX.ORG.RU

Raid1 или LVM?


0

0

Добрый день!
Есть 2 новых диска одинаковых размеров, еще 1 старый и материнка с чипом за 10$ (jMicron) которая умеет AHCI Intel 10 и Raid.
Хочу ускорить работы файловой подсистемы, что собственно лучше (если не брать в расчет отказоустойчивость)?

★★

материнка с чипом за 10$ (jMicron) которая умеет AHCI Intel 10 и Raid.

Не умеет.

Хочу ускорить работы файловой подсистемы, что собственно лучше (если не брать в расчет отказоустойчивость)?

Быстрее? RAID0 или LVM Stripe (физически - это одно и то же).

Deleted
()
Ответ на: комментарий от Deleted

Хотя нужно ещё уточнить, что именно тебе нужно ускорить - чтение или запись? И насколько тебе наплевать на отказоустойчивость?

Deleted
()

У меня на материнке ECS A785GM-M JMicron JMB362. Поставил контроллёр в режим AHCI (другие режимы: IDE и RAID). Поднял на нём софтверный RAID-1 на ZFS и UFS2 (gmirror) из разделов двух дисков. Работает нормально. (Сейчас стоит один винт, но большей ёмкости.)

iZEN ★★★★★
()

Хочется «совсем быстро» и плевать на надежность?
1. На старом диске создаем один раздел на весь диск с типом RAID autodetect (sda1)
2. На новых дисках создаем по два раздела (sdb1,sdb2 и sdc1,sdc2) - sdb1 и sdc1 равные по размеру разделу со старого диска, sdb2 и sdc2 yf все остальное место
3. Создаем два md-массива в режиме stripe (чередование), первый массив sda1+sdb1+sdc1 и второй sdb2+sdc2
4. Оба md-массива инициализируем в physical volume и создаем на них LVM
Быстерй ничего не выйдет, отказойстойчивость нулевая

Nastishka ★★★★★
()

raid, а поверх - LVM, практика показывается, что если просто на рейде разбивать разделы, то в итоге всё будет жутко тормозить.

scaldov ★★
()

>материнка с чипом за 10$ (jMicron) которая умеет AHCI Intel 10 и Raid.
Если raid не нужен в альтернативных ОС — забей на этот чип.
Сделай софтовый raid0 (или 2 raid0 + собрать в LVM как linear) и не забудь предупредить об этом ФС (ext* неслабо ускоряются,reiserfs афаик нет)

x3al ★★★★★
()
Ответ на: комментарий от x3al

Все, уговорили попробовать:)
В итоге диски расколотил на 4 партиции.
На первой партиции - raid1 /boot, второй swap,
на третьем создал опять raid1 под /, на четвертом raid0
и поверх размазал LVM для хомяка.
Осталось только систему перекопировать, chroot и пересобрать ядро:))

vadv ★★
() автор топика
Ответ на: комментарий от x3al

Shocked!

RAID1+LVM+EXT4:

time dd if=/dev/zero of=zero.dat bs=1M count=700
700+0 records in
700+0 records out
734003200 bytes (734 MB) copied, 3.64584 s, 201 MB/s

real 0m3.679s
user 0m0.003s
sys 0m0.982s

RAID0+EXT4:
time dd if=/dev/zero of=zero.dat bs=1M count=700
700+0 records in
700+0 records out
734003200 bytes (734 MB) copied, 10.9807 s, 66.8 MB/s

real 0m10.982s
user 0m0.002s
sys 0m1.255

vadv ★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.